In this episode of The Defiant Podcast, we sit down with Paul Veradittakit, Managing Partner at Pantera Capital, to discuss the explosive growth of Solana, the future of stablecoins, and the evolution of digital asset treasury companies. Paul shares insights on Pantera's $1.2 billion Solana fund, the role of institutional capital in this crypto cycle, and why he believes Solana is poised to outperform Bitcoin and Ethereum.
